This paper studies the spatial patterns and the determinants of intellectual property rights (IPRs). I ̄nd evidence of spatial correlation in the strength of IPRs provided by di®erent countries. This spatial association persists after controlling for domestic socio-political and economic variables that can a®ect the choice of IPRs and which could potentially be correlated in space. Opioids reduce injury from myocardial ischemia-reperfusion in humans. In experimental models, this mechanism involves GSK3β inhibition. HSP90 regulates mitochondrial protein import, with GSK3β inhibition increasing HSP90 mitochondrial content. Sustained cell proliferation requires telomerase to maintain functional telomeres that are essential for chromosome integrity and protection. Although nuclear import of telomerase transcriptase (hTERT) is required for telomerase activity to elongate telomeres in vivo, the molecular mechanism regulating nuclear localization of hTERT is unclear. Countries have long used import tari↵s as an instrument to stimulate or protect downstream industries; however, in the GATT/WTO era, tari↵s have fallen greatly worldwide. Has the WTO succeeded in limiting the prevalence of this class of industrial policy, or are governments still attempting to move downstream via other policy instruments? BACKGROUND Insulin-dependent Type 1 diabetes (T1D) is a devastating autoimmune disease that destroys beta cells within the pancreatic islets and afflicts over 10 million people worldwide. These patients face life-long risks for blindness, cardiovascular and renal diseases, and complications of insulin treatment.
